The summer transfer window is now in full swing, with the market back open again.
The Reds have already brought in Jeremie Frimpong from Bayer Leverkusen and have agreed a British record deal with the German side for Florian Wirtz.
The Premier League champions will pay £116million in total to sign the playmaker, with his medical scheduled for Friday.
They are also close to agreeing a £45m deal for Bournemouth left-back Milos Kerkez.
Meanwhile, Arsenal continue to work to sign a new striker, with Viktor Gyokeres their top target.
But the Swedish star has now received a 'monster' rival offer that could throw a spanner in the works.
And Kyle Walker has been handed a lifeline to continue his top-flight career, with his time at Manchester City over.
The right-back spent the second-half of last season on loan at AC Milan and is now eyeing a shock move to Everton.
